FREEZER BREAKFAST SANDWICHES



Freezer Breakfast Sandwiches image

Love this one! With just 30 minutes of preparation on Sunday and I have 3 sandwiches each for my husband & I for the week. Only 2 minutes in the microwave and the best part, no dirty dishes to clean up!

Provided by HannahSilvestre8214

Categories     100+ Breakfast and Brunch Recipes     Eggs     Breakfast Sandwich Recipes

Time 30m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 7

6 sausage patties
coconut oil cooking spray
6 eggs, divided
6 dashes cayenne pepper, divided
salt and ground black pepper to taste
6 whole grain English muffins, split and toasted
6 slices American processed cheese

Steps:

  •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Cook sausage patties in the hot skillet, turning often, until sausage is cooked through and browned, 10 to 12 minutes. Remove patties to a paper-towel lined plate.
  • Meanwhile, coat a 3-inch mini frying pan with coconut oil cooking spray and place over medium heat. Whisk 1 egg and 1 dash of cayenne pepper in a small bowl and season with salt and pepper. Pour egg mixture into frying pan. Cook, without stirring, until set on the bottom, about 1 1/2 minutes. Flip egg and cook, without stirring, until set on the other side, about 1 minute more. Remove from heat, place on a plate, and repeat with remaining eggs and cayenne pepper.
  • Assemble breakfast sandwiches when eggs and sausage are cool: place an egg patty on the bottom piece of an English muffin, top with a slice of cheese, a sausage patty, and the English muffin top. Wrap in aluminum foil and freeze.
  • Unwrap and microwave each sandwich for 2 minutes when ready to eat.

FREEZER BREAKFAST SANDWICHES



Freezer Breakfast Sandwiches image

On busy mornings, these freezer breakfast sandwiches save the day. A hearty combo of eggs, Canadian bacon and cheese will keep you fueled through lunchtime and beyond. -Christine Rukavena, Taste of Home Senior Editor

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 40m

Yield 12 sandwiches.

Number Of Ingredients 9

12 large eggs
2/3 cup 2% milk
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
SANDWICHES:
12 English muffins, split
4 tablespoons butter, softened
12 slices Colby-Monterey Jack cheese
12 slices Canadian bacon

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325°. In a large bowl, whisk eggs, milk, salt and pepper until blended. Pour into a 13x9-in. baking pan coated with cooking spray. Bake until set, 15-18 minutes. Cool on a wire rack., Meanwhile, toast English muffins (or bake at 325° until lightly browned, 12-15 minutes). Spread 1 tsp. butter on each muffin bottom., Cut eggs into 12 portions. Layer muffin bottoms with an egg portion, a cheese slice (tearing cheese to fit) and Canadian bacon. Replace muffin tops. Wrap sandwiches in waxed paper and then in foil; freeze in a freezer container., To use frozen sandwiches: Remove foil. Microwave a waxed paper-wrapped sandwich at 50% power until thawed, 1-2 minutes. Turn sandwich over; microwave at 100% power until hot and a thermometer reads at least 160°, 30-60 seconds. Let stand 2 minutes before serving.

FREEZE-AHEAD BREAKFAST SANDWICHES



Freeze-Ahead Breakfast Sandwiches image

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Breakfast Eggs

Time 44m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

4 eggs, beaten
6 English muffins, split, toasted
1 pkg. (9 oz.) OSCAR MAYER Deli Fresh Smoked Ham
6 KRAFT Singles

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F.
  • Pour eggs into 8-inch square baking dish sprayed with cooking spray. Bake 12 to 14 min. or just until eggs are set. Cut into 6 pieces; cool completely.
  • Fill English muffins with eggs and ham to make 6 sandwiches. Wrap individually in plastic wrap. Place wrapped sandwiches in freezer-weight resealable plastic bag; seal bag. Freeze up to 6 weeks.
  • Place 1 unwrapped sandwich on microwaveable plate just before serving. Open sandwich and add 1 Singles to filling; replace top of sandwich. Microwave on HIGH 1 min. or until sandwich is heated through. Repeat with remaining sandwiches if necessary for additional servings.
